Step 1: Create Your Research Paper Topic
Before taking up your research, you need to choose your topic. Recognizing that architecture is a broad field with different topics such as history, philosophy, design theory, etc. Consult essay writing reviews and pick the best materials to develop your research, from the topic to the overall content of your research.
Step 2: Gather Your Best Resources
After choosing your research topic, the next thing to do is to get relevant information to proceed with your research.
You would need to use available journals and architectural research papers vital to your architecture paper. Don’t forget to credit the original owners of these materials by referencing them at each point you glean from their knowledge.
It’s also possible to acquire resources by organizing a survey, sending out questionnaires or developing research questions.
On another note, you could opt for the best research writing services to save time with the research process.
Step 3: Structure The Research Paper
Arrange the points of your research in a well-structured format. This makes it readable. In addition, it’ll allow a consistent flow and connection of thoughts when it is read.
Recall that your abstract and introduction are two vital elements of your research paper. These two must be generated properly to retain the attention of your readers till the end of your research paper.
Finally, a well-structured research paper speaks of competence and expertise whenever professionals see or examine its content.
Step 4: Review Your Work
Once you’re done writing, a proper review is needed on your architectural research paper. This is vital to correct errors in the article.
With the help of editing tools, especially Grammarly and the Hemingway App, you can easily edit errors and produce easy-to-read articles that your audience will understand.
What else? Cite the articles you source from properly to acknowledge the use of others’ ideas.
